    Director, Medical Strategy

    Reports to SVP, Medical Strategy
    Job Summary
    The Director, Medical Strategy plays a pivotal role in driving strategic medical direction within OPEN Health's Scientific Communications practice. This role involves spearheading the development of comprehensive Medical Affairs strategies and corresponding medical plans. Additionally, the Director fosters and cultivates robust client partnerships, ensuring alignment with and realization of strategic objectives.

    The Director also actively partners on new business development efforts, identifying and capitalizing on opportunities to expand the company's portfolio and impact in the industry.

    Essential Duties & Responsibilities
    Leveraging subject matter expertise to synthesize actionable insights from a situation analysis into tangible strategic drivers and corresponding solutions for Medical Affairs plan elements

    Overseeing the formulation and execution of strategic medical content for communication planning initiatives, encompassing tailored analytics projects, scientific platform development, evidence gap assessments, and comprehensive tactical plans.

    Leading the direction and implementation of these initiatives, ensuring alignment with client goals and industry standards while driving innovation and excellence in strategy development
    Overseeing the development of strategic medical content for new business opportunities/proposals; support orchestration and delivery of customized capabilities presentations for prospective clients
    Driving engagement and facilitating meaningful dialogue during scientific and strategic discussions with clients and external experts to achieve desired outcomes
    Driving continuous improvement and innovation in processes, methodologies, and deliverables to optimize efficiency and quality across all strategic Medical Affairs project deliverables
    Providing training and support to internal teams on medical strategy
    Elevating, expanding and refining the strategic offerings of OPEN Health's Medical Strategy department
    Directing the development of comprehensive medical strategies tailored to each client's needs, fostering collaboration across teams to optimize the onboarding process and maximize client satisfaction
    Strategically monitoring and staying abreast of the evolving Medical Affairs landscape, emerging industry trends, and evolving standards, with a keen focus on target therapeutic area dynamics and pharmaceutical/biotech company pipelines; leveraging insights gained from active participation in pertinent medical and trade conferences to inform strategic decision-making and drive innovation within the organization
    Championing thought leadership initiatives and cultivating relationships to drive business growth and advance organizational objective
    Experience, Skills, and Qualifications
    Advanced Life Sciences degree (PharmD, PhD, MD, DO) from an accredited university.
    Minimum of 8 years experience working in a Medical Affairs consultancy or medical communications agency, or within the Medical Affairs division of a pharmaceutical company; prior training as a Medical Writer and/or Medical Director is a plus
    In-depth experience in leading the delivery of key offerings of Medical Affairs service providers, particularly medical plans, evidence generation plans, stakeholder engagement plans, and medical and/or value communications
    Ability to lead discussions around science and strategy with external stakeholders at all levels
    Proficient in synthesizing complex market and/or product information and distilling key learnings and insights into meaningful, actionable strategic recommendations
    Ability to apply subject matter expertise across multiple therapeutic categories and disease states as well as project types
    Direct the work of junior team members and help lead them to achieve best performance by instilling confidence and building morale
    Advanced project management, time management, organization, and prioritization skills
    Excellent written and verbal communication skills, including outstanding presentation development and delivery skills
    Ability to manage multiple and sometimes competing challenges, issues, and priorities with the ability to delegate, problem solve, and set clear expectations
    Ability to meet billability targets while delivering high-quality work and managing competing priorities is essential for success in this role
    Enthusiastic, team player, self-motivated attitude and demeanor
    Advanced knowledge of MS365 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Teams and Outlook; working knowledge of online collaboration tools
    Travel Requirements
    25%-40% travel, including internationally, may be required
